Hello! I'm an educator, keynote speaker and researcher with a passion for creating practical solutions for a resilient and equitable future. In 2013, I co-founded the Institute for Global Solutions (IGS), a groundbreaking public school program designed to empower teenagers to make a meaningful impact on the world. What began as a modest experiment with just 23 students has flourished into a vibrant program with nearly 200 learners each year.

 

My mission is to transform educational narratives and inspire positive change. I teach high school students in the IGS program and also instruct undergraduate and master's students at the University of Victoria and Royal Roads University.
